Frances Bonner was born in 1917 in Chesnee, South Carolina in the foothills of the Blue Ridge mountains. Her family moved from there to a farm in Mountain Rest, South Carolina. She grew up in Mountain Rest with her brothers Charlie, Bill, Homer, Steve and Baxter along with her sisters Betty and Ruth. Her home place is now gone but the lake her father and uncle built still remains and that is where she built a home on the lake and where she loved to visit. Frances left home as a young adult and was a civilian plane spotter during World War II in Florida. There she met Harold Huff from Gloster, Mississippi who was in the Army Air Corp. They married and had two daughters, Dianne and Nancy. After the war Harold and Frances moved their family to Texas. As time went by, Dianne married Rhett Butler and Nancy married William (Buzz) Oliver and gave Frances three grandchildren, Michael, Julie and Danny. The family grew again when Mike married Tammy, Danny married Jenny and Julie married Terry and Frances’s life was enriched even more with the addition of her 6 great-grandchildren Autumn, Hunter, Haley, Kelsey, Brendan and Caroline. Haley married Ronny and the family increased again with two great-great granddaughters, Ronni Avalynne and Haven. Last Christmas was a joyous celebration for Frances with five generations of her family present! Frances’s life was summed up by Jenny when Jenny wrote: “the 18 years I’ve known her I witnessed a profound sense of duty to her Savior to love everyone, to be compassionate without judgement and to care for her family. Her laughter was infectious and her classiness top notch. Always proper, always thankful, a ball of energy and a blessing to all who knew her or crossed her path. Definitely one of a kind”.
